Привет, я Максим Осин

Fullstack разработчик

Мой стек технологий

Frontend

TypeScript, Astro, Blazor, React + (React Router 6, React Hook Form), Zustand, Axios, TailwindCSS, PostCSS, Vite, Feature-Sliced Design

Backend

.NET 5+, C#, ASP NET Core, EF Core, REST API, ErrorOr, Mapster, xUnit, Moq, FluentAssertions, Nginx, Clean Architecture

Базы данных

PostgreSQL, MS SQL Server, MongoDB, SQLite, LiteDB

IDE и прочее...

Rider, Zed, VS Code, Fleet, Git, Make, Trello, Docker/Podman, Docker-compose

Образование

Бийский Государственный Колледж

Специальность: 09.02.04 Информационные системы (2019-2023)

Читал и вам рекомендую

Албахари — С# 9.0. Полный справочник

Сергей Тепляков — Паттерны проектирования на .NET

Марк Симан — Внедрение зависимостей в .NET

Эндрю Лок — ASP.NET Core в действии

Джон Смит — EF Core в действии

Роберт Мартин — Чистая архитектура

Роберт Мартин — Чистый код

Обо мне

В 8 классе изучал C++ в инженерном клубе, где успешно окончил год обучения и даже поучаствовал в городских олимпиадах.

Какое-то время занимался разработкой игр на Unity, где и приобщился к C#.

Уже в колледже взялся за backend, чем и занимаюсь с середины 2022 года, а через год решил охватить навыки и frontend разработки. Получается, что теперь я fullstack.